Common Postural Mistakes



When it pertains to preserving good stance, numerous individuals unconsciously make typical errors that can add to pain in the back and discomfort. One of the most widespread errors is slouching or stooping over while sitting or standing. This placement places excessive stress on the back and can result in muscle mass imbalances and discomfort over time.

Another common blunder is overarching the lower back, which can squash the natural curve of the spine and trigger discomfort. In addition, going across legs while sitting might feel comfy, but it can develop a discrepancy in the hips and pelvis, leading to postural concerns.

Using a cushion that's also soft or as well firm while resting can additionally affect your alignment and add to pain in the back. Last but not least, constantly craning your neck to look at displays or adjusting your setting regularly can stress the neck and shoulders. Being mindful of these common postural errors can assist you keep better alignment and reduce the risk of back pain.

Tips for Correcting Placement



To enhance your positioning and reduce neck and back pain, it's vital to concentrate on making small adjustments throughout your day-to-day routine. Begin by being mindful of your position. When resting, ensure your feet are flat on the floor, your back is straight, and your shoulders are kicked back. Stay clear of slouching or leaning to one side. Usage ergonomic chairs or pillows to support your lower back.



When standing, distribute your weight equally on both feet, maintain your knees a little bent, and tuck in your pelvis. Engage your core muscular tissues to sustain your spine. Take breaks to extend and walk if you have a sedentary task. Integrate workouts that enhance your core and back muscle mass, such as planks or bridges.

While sleeping, utilize a cushion that supports the natural contour of your neck to preserve appropriate back positioning. Avoid sleeping on your belly, as it can stress your neck and back. By being mindful of these suggestions and making small modifications, you can slowly correct your positioning and alleviate pain in the back.
